This function allows users to combine multiple successive runs of
redist.mcmc.mpi into a single redist object for analysis.
redist.combine.mpi returns an object of class "redist".
The object redist is a list that contains the following components (the
inclusion of some components is dependent on whether tempering
techniques are used):
plans | 
 Matrix of congressional district assignments generated by the algorithm. Each row corresponds to a geographic unit, and each column corresponds to a simulation.  | 
distance_parity | 
 Vector containing the maximum distance from parity for a particular simulated redistricting plan.  | 
mhdecisions | 
 A vector specifying whether a proposed redistricting plan was accepted (1) or rejected (0) in a given iteration.  | 
mhprob | 
 A vector containing the Metropolis-Hastings acceptance probability for each iteration of the algorithm.  | 
pparam | 
 A vector containing the draw of the   | 
constraint_pop | 
 A vector containing the value of the population constraint for each accepted redistricting plan.  | 
constraint_compact | 
 A vector containing the value of the compactness constraint for each accepted redistricting plan.  | 
constraint_vra | 
 A vector containing the value of the vra constraint for each accepted redistricting plan.  | 
constraint_similar | 
 A vector containing the value of the similarity constraint for each accepted redistricting plan.  | 
constraint_qps | 
 A vector containing the value of the QPS constraint for each accepted redistricting plan.  | 
beta_sequence | 
 A vector containing the value of beta for each iteration of the algorithm. Returned when tempering is being used.  | 
mhdecisions_beta | 
 A vector specifying whether a proposed beta value was accepted (1) or rejected (0) in a given iteration of the algorithm. Returned when tempering is being used.  | 
mhprob_beta | 
 A vector containing the Metropolis-Hastings acceptance probability for each iteration of the algorithm. Returned when tempering is being used.  |
